BlockSDN-VC: A SDN-Based Virtual Coordinate-Enhanced Transaction Broadcast Framework for High-Performance Blockchains

Modern blockchains need fast, reliable propagation to balance security and throughput. Virtual-coordinate methods speed dissemination but rely on slow iterative updates, leaving nodes out of sync. We present BlockSDN-VC, a transaction-broadcast protocol that centralises coordinate computation and forwarding control in an SDN controller, delivering global consistency, minimal path stretch and rapid response to churn or congestion. In geo-distributed simulations, BlockSDN-VC cuts median latency by up to 62% and accelerates convergence fourfold over state-of-the-art schemes with under 3% control-plane overhead. In a real blockchain environment, BlockSDN-VC boosts confirmed-transaction throughput by 17% under adversarial workloads, requiring no modifications to existing clients.
